#463238 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#463238 is composed of 27.5% red, 19.6%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 28.6% magenta, 20% yellow and 72.5% black. It has a hue angle of 342 degrees, a saturation of 16.7% and a lightness of 23.5%. #463238 color hex could be obtained by blending #8c6470 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333333.

● #463238 color description : Very dark grayish pink.
#463238 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#463238 has RGB values of R:70, G:50, B:56 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.29, Y:0.2, K:0.73. Its decimal value is 4600376.
